Public Access to Court Proceedings and Documents
Public access to court proceedings and documents is fundamental to ensuring transparency and accountability in administrative courts. It allows the public, legal professionals, and stakeholders to observe judicial processes and scrutinize decisions, fostering a culture of openness.
Key mechanisms include open court sessions and accessible documentation. These enable individuals to follow contested cases and understand legal reasoning behind rulings. The availability of records also supports thorough oversight by external bodies.
Practices that promote such access include:
- Conducting proceedings in open sessions unless classified for specific reasons.
- Publishing court decisions and rulings promptly through official platforms.
- Providing electronic access to documents, transcripts, and case files.
Implementing these measures enhances the integrity of the judicial process and reinforces public trust in administrative courts. Balancing transparency with confidentiality, especially in sensitive cases, remains a vital aspect of this approach.

Challenges to Transparency in Administrative Courts
Several obstacles hinder the realization of transparency in administrative courts. One primary challenge is the inherent confidentiality of certain proceedings, which limits public access to sensitive information and documents. This confidentiality, while often necessary, can reduce openness and accountability.
Legal restrictions and bureaucratic procedures also contribute to transparency issues. Complex processes and overly strict access rules may create barriers for the public and stakeholders seeking information. These procedural hurdles often reduce the effectiveness of transparency mechanisms.
Additionally, there is often resistance within judicial institutions to fully embracing transparency initiatives. Judicial independence may sometimes be perceived as a reason to restrict information sharing, fearing interference or politicization. This resistance can slow reforms and inhibit the development of transparent practices.
- Restrictions on public access due to confidentiality.
- Procedural complexities and bureaucratic barriers.
- Resistance within judicial institutions to transparency reforms.

Strengthening Judicial Independence and Integrity
Strengthening judicial independence and integrity is vital for ensuring transparency and accountability in administrative courts. An independent judiciary can make impartial decisions without undue influence, fostering public trust in administrative law courts.
To achieve this, legal reforms often include safeguarding judges from external pressures, such as political or administrative interference. Clear rules on judicial tenure and safeguards against arbitrary removal are fundamental in this effort.
Additionally, mechanisms like transparent appointment processes and regular evaluations help uphold judicial integrity. These practices promote merit-based selection and discourage corruption, reinforcing public confidence.
- Implement transparent and merit-based judicial appointment procedures.
- Enforce strict codes of conduct and ethical standards for judges.
- Ensure independence by providing adequate tenure protections.
- Conduct regular training on ethical obligations and transparency principles.
By adopting these strategies, administrative courts can bolster their capacity to deliver fair, unbiased judgments, ultimately strengthening accountability and public perception of judicial fairness.
